OFFICIAL TRAILER DEBUT
From the directors of Wild Wild Country and Untold
THE KINGS OF TUPELO:
A SOUTHERN CRIME SAGA
A small-town feud, an internet conspiracy, an Elvis impersonator, black market body parts, and an assassination attempt on the President. Welcome to Mississippi where this jaw-dropping story spirals from local drama to a national scandal. Buckle up for a wild ride. This isn't fiction - it's Tupelo.
A Stardust Frames and C2 Motion Picture Production
In association with Berlanti Productions & Warner-Horizon Television
Releases on Netflix: December 11th
Format: 3 Episodes; Documentary Series
Directed By: Chapman Way & Maclain Way (Wild Wild Country, Untold)
Executive Producers: Juliana Lembi, Chapman Way, Maclain Way, Dave Caplan, Greg Berlanti, Sarah Schechter, David Madden, Mike Darnell, Brooke Karzen, Bridgette Theriault, Dan Sacks
Co-Executive Producer: Dannah Shinder and Leigh London Redman
